I. What are Control Arm Bushings?

Control arm bushings are critical parts of a lorry's shock absorber. They act as a crucial web link in between the automobile's framework and the suspension elements, enabling controlled movement and soaking up roadway shocks and resonances. Control arm bushings are normally made from rubber or polyurethane and are developed to offer flexibility while keeping architectural stability.

II. The Function of Lower Control Arm Bushings:

The control arm is a vital part of the shock absorber, attaching the automobile's frame to the wheel center. The reduced control arm is a essential component that plays a substantial function in supporting the weight of the vehicle and regulating the motion of the wheels. Lower control arm bushings are placed at the points where the control arm attaches to the structure and the wheel hub.

The key feature of lower control arm bushings is to separate the control arm from the chassis, lowering resonances and noise sent from the road. In addition, they enable controlled motion of the control arm, enabling smooth handling and a comfy trip. Over time, these bushings might wear out because of constant motion, exposure to the aspects, and general deterioration.

III. Signs of Worn Lower Control Arm Bushings:

Comprehending the signs of used reduced control arm bushings is important for prompt replacement and keeping the optimal efficiency of your vehicle. Right here are some usual indicators that your lower control arm bushings might need interest:

Sound and Vibrations: Worn bushings can bring about increased roadway sound and vibrations felt in the guiding wheel. If you notice a Control Arm Bushing clunking or knocking noise when driving over bumps, maybe a indicator of weakening reduced control arm bushings.

Irregular Tire Wear: Faulty control arm bushings can lead to irregular tire wear. Inspect your tires consistently, and if you notice unusual wear patterns, it might show a trouble with the suspension components, including reduced control arm bushings.

Taking care of Issues: As control arm bushings deteriorate, they can impact the automobile's handling. If you experience trouble guiding, inadequate cornering, or a wandering sensation while driving, it could be attributed to used lower control arm bushings.

IV. Value of Timely Substitute:

Overlooking worn lower control arm bushings can lead to several issues that affect the security and performance of your automobile. Timely replacement is necessary for the adhering to factors:

Improved Security: Appropriately operating control arm bushings add to steady and foreseeable handling. Replacing worn bushings lower control arm bushing improves the overall safety of your vehicle by guaranteeing optimal control and responsiveness.

Extended Tire Life: Worn control arm bushings can create imbalance concerns, causing unequal tire wear. By replacing the bushings quickly, you can extend the life of your tires and stay clear of the demand for early replacements.

Improved Convenience: New control arm bushings add to a smoother experience by efficiently absorbing roadway shocks and resonances. This improves overall driving convenience for both the motorist and travelers.
